Advantages Over Traditional Capex
This novel financing playbook offers Alphabet at least three distinct advantages over traditional capital expenditure approaches. Firstly, it promises a lower cost of capital. Green bonds, particularly those tied to tangible renewable Assets, typically price 25 to 50 basis points tighter than equivalent corporate bonds, reflecting strong investor appetite and perceived lower risk.
Secondly, the structure allows for off-balance-sheet treatment. By not classifying these bonds as direct corporate liabilities, Alphabet can secure the necessary funding without negatively impacting its key credit ratios, preserving financial flexibility. Thirdly, and perhaps most critically for long-term operational planning, these bonds offer multi-decade power price certainty.
This effectively removes the volatile risk of energy inflation from the operating cost models of its AI data centres, providing a stable and predictable cost base for its computationally intensive AI workloads.

ESG Alignment and Investor Demand
The structure’s emphasis on green bonds directly addresses the escalating demand for environmentally sound investments. Pension funds and sovereign wealth accounts, often managing vast sums, are increasingly seeking to align their portfolios with sustainability goals. By issuing bonds tied to specific renewable energy projects, Alphabet not only secures financing but also provides these institutional investors with a compliant and attractive asset.
This alignment is crucial, as these investors explicitly require green bond allocations. The long duration of these bonds further appeals to investors with long-term liabilities, such as pension funds, allowing them to match assets with future obligations. This symbiotic relationship between Alphabet's AI ambitions and the growing ESG investment universe creates a powerful engine for sustainable growth in the technology sector.
Future Outlook and Potential Risks
Alphabet's innovative financing strategy represents a sophisticated adaptation to the unique demands of AI infrastructure development. The potential for multi-decade power price certainty is a particularly compelling advantage, shielding the company from the vagaries of energy markets. However, the long-term nature of these bonds, tied to specific projects, could introduce complexities.
Should a particular renewable energy project face unforeseen operational challenges or delays, it could impact the power Supply or associated costs for the data centres. Furthermore, while off-balance-sheet treatment offers accounting benefits, regulators and rating agencies may scrutinise such structures for potential hidden risks.
